Определено, что депрескрайбинг при ХСН имеет крайне ограниченный потенциал применения из-за доказанного очевидного влияния ряда групп ЛС на прогноз и выраженность клинической симптоматики у пациентов с ХСН.</p></abstract><trans-abstract xml:lang="en"><p>Deprescribing is a scheduled withdrawal, dose reduction, or replacement of a medicine with a safer one. Several groups of medicinal products (MPs) are used simultaneously in the treatment of chronic heart failure. This increases the risk of adverse drug reactions, particularly in elderly and senile patients. A systematic search for literature allowed evaluating possibilities of deprescribing for the following pharmaceutic groups: 1) MPs influencing the renin-angiotensin-aldosterone system; 2) beta-blockers; 3) digoxin; and 4) diuretics. Three systematic reviews and several studies were analyzed to determine the most feasible and potentially optimal regimens of deprescribing in CHF. It was established that in CHF, deprescribing has a very limited potential for use due to the documented, obvious effect of some MP groups on prediction and severity of clinical symptoms in CHF patients.</p></trans-abstract><kwd-group xml:lang="ru"><kwd>Cердечная недостаточность</kwd><kwd>пожилой и старческий возраст</kwd><kwd>депрескрайбинг</kwd><kwd>полипрагмазия</kwd><kwd>ингибиторы ангиотензинпревращающего фермента</kwd><kwd>блокаторы рецепторов к ангиотензину II</kwd><kwd>бета-блокаторы</kwd><kwd>диуретики</kwd><kwd>дигоксин</kwd></kwd-group><kwd-group xml:lang="en"><kwd>Heart failure</kwd><kwd>elderly and senile age</kwd><kwd>deprescribing</kwd><kwd>polypragmasia</kwd><kwd>angiotensin-converting enzyme inhibitors</kwd><kwd>angiotensin II receptor blockers</kwd><kwd>beta-blockers</kwd><kwd>diuretics</kwd><kwd>digoxin</kwd></kwd-group><funding-group><funding-statement xml:lang="ru">нет</funding-statement></funding-group></article-meta></front><back><ref-list><title>References</title><ref id="cit1"><label>1</label><citation-alternatives><mixed-citation xml:lang="ru">Jetha S.
